Land of Volcanos
There are over 100 volcanos in El Salvador and 20 that are currently active. Out of all of them, Santa Ana scores the tallest being at 2,381 meters above sea level!
The Test of Time
Capital city, San Salvador, is the longest standing capital city in Central America. It currently stands at 500 years old!
The August Festival
Fiesta de San Salvador is a national holiday celebrated August 6th. It is a festival to celebrate and honor the Transfiguration of Jesus Christ.
New Bloom
The Flor de Izote, (the Yucca flower) is El Salvador's national flower. It represents new opportunities, loyalty, protection and purity.
